The libsemigroups library is used in the Semigroups package for GAP. Some of the features of Semigroupe 2.01 are not yet implemented in libsemigroups; this is a work in progress. Missing features include those for: - Green's relations, or classes - finding a zero - minimal ideal, principal left/right ideals, or indeed any ideals - inverses - local submonoids - the kernel - variety tests. These will be included in a future version. Libsemigroups performs roughly the same as Semigroupe 2.01 when there is a known upper bound on the size of the semigroup being enumerated, and this is used to initialize the data structures for the semigroup; see libsemigroups::Semigroup::reserve for more details. Note that in Semigroupe 2.01 it is always necessary to provide such an upper bound, but in libsemigroups it is not.
